* Nathaniel Smith:
> Oh, sure, it's obviously waiting on IO. The question is what IO are
> we doing that takes so long, and how can we not do that :-).
It's probably the effect of internal database fragmentation, coupled
with file system fragementation:
monotone.db: 8686 extents found, perfection would be 1 extent
Running VACUUM seems to help quite a bit, defragmenting the file at
the file system level doesn't make such a big difference.
(But this is for reading the certs before pull. I didn't notice soon
enough that this thread is about push performance.)
